A great little microbrewery just a little way off of the Northern Sacramento rail trail to Rio Linda. I'm almost glad it is not in my own immediate neighborhood, as I could see myself spending an inordinate amount of time there. Very cozy snd inviting.

I usually dislike craft beer. But I'll tell you, King Cong has some great tasting beer selections and the food is KILLER. They have SUPER-good pizzas and other smaller plates, and the atmosphere and outdoor seating area is great for a hot summer afternoon. The staff are also friendly, the owners really care about and are involved with the local community, and they also have live entertainment some evenings. I really like this place to just kick back and have some good food and a few drinks with friends.

I am a huge fan of King Cong beers. Everytime I see a new brew I pick it up, since there's a high chance I'm going to love it. That is why I was excited to visit their brewery. Looking at the location on Google Maps, I could tell it wasn't in the best area of Sacramento. It was disheartening to see the brewery wasn't as I imagined. It was messy and looked thrown together. It appears King Cong brewery puts more consideration into their beer than they do their brewery. Although, I enjoyed the beer, it's not a place I'd want to linger long. It would not be a great date spot, because of the location. It's a sketchy area and I wouldn't want to wander far from the brewery. My suggestion is: put your brewery supplies in the back and not where the customers can see them, add comfortable seating, provide games to encourage customers to stay longer and create a more inviting patio area.
